Andrew Eisenberg
534192fa05
Use externalRepoAuth when getting a remote config
...
This allows users to specify a different token for retrieving the
codeql config from a different repository.
Fixes https://github.com/github/advanced-security-field/issues/185
2021-04-09 15:00:57 -07:00
Robin Neatherway
dff118f7ad
Use version information to construct payload
2020-11-30 16:45:18 +00:00
Robert
81a21bfa1e
Request meta endpoint at the start of execution
2020-11-26 17:54:46 +00:00
Sam Partington
3ee4739b13
Make anonymous objects into variables for readability
2020-11-24 11:23:53 +00:00
Sam Partington
20567b5888
Introduce parameter object for API params that travel together
2020-11-23 14:39:01 +00:00
Eric Cornelissen
6aaf0483f0
Merge branch 'main' into fix-typos
2020-11-20 14:32:12 +01:00
Eric Cornelissen
5416d4f3b5
Run npm run build
2020-11-20 11:35:59 +01:00
Eric Cornelissen
847f4ef293
Run npm run build
2020-11-19 23:03:45 +01:00
Chris Gavin
b16110e60e
Log the version warning a second time if a request fails unexpectedly.
2020-11-03 12:57:15 +00:00
Chris Gavin
1a4385d516
Only log the version warning once on Actions even if the Action is invoked multiple times.
2020-11-02 09:01:36 +00:00
Chris Gavin
865b4bd832
Pass a logger in to getApiClient() rather than constructing one there.
2020-11-02 08:53:25 +00:00
Chris Gavin
1f7bae7ab8
Use an undefined check rather than hasOwnProperty.
2020-11-02 08:47:11 +00:00
Chris Gavin
1220ae5bfd
Log a warning if the API version is not supported.
2020-10-30 12:20:06 +00:00
Chris Raynor
122c9b7f24
Switching to import/order instead of sort-imports
2020-10-01 11:03:46 +01:00
Chris Raynor
228546a1e5
Resolve violations of sort-imports lint
...
Resolves #206
2020-09-29 14:43:37 +01:00
Chris Gavin
31c2eca167
Fix retrying uploads by using Octokit retry plugin.
2020-09-21 19:15:19 +01:00
Chris Gavin
cc0eb452c7
Use getOctokit(...) when getting the GitHub API client.
2020-09-21 15:21:05 +01:00
Chris Gavin
9ed519fa12
Update to the latest version of @actions/github.
2020-09-18 16:06:20 +01:00
Robert Brignull
c1cee53da5
Add getOptionalInput and getRequiredInput
2020-09-15 18:47:50 +01:00
Robert Brignull
121fd331cd
Introduce actions-util.ts
2020-09-15 14:01:21 +01:00
Chris Raynor
a184d50a26
Running lint-fix
2020-09-14 10:44:43 +01:00
Robert Brignull
3dfaa88a1d
Remove process of auth
2020-08-27 16:45:28 +01:00
Robert Brignull
f5d645fc73
Fix use of wrong URL
2020-08-26 16:20:36 +01:00
Robert Brignull
217483dfd6
Convert rest of the actions
2020-08-26 16:20:36 +01:00
Robert Brignull
cf08f5a9cd
remove unused arguments
2020-08-11 13:56:23 +01:00
Robert Brignull
34b372292b
commit node_modules and generated files
2020-08-11 12:43:27 +01:00
Andrew Eisenberg
42235cc048
Allow the codeql-action to be run locally ( #117 )
...
* Allow the codeql-action to be run locally
This change allows the codeql-action to be run locally through
[act](https://github.com/nektos/act ).
In order to run the action locally, you need to do two things:
1. Add the `CODEQL_LOCAL_RUN: true` environment variable. The only way
I could figure out how to do this was to add it directly in the
workflow file in an `env` block. It _should_ be possible to add it
through a `.env` file and pass it to `act`, but I couldn't get it
working.
2. Run this command `act -j codeql -s GITHUB_TOKEN=<MY_PAT>`
Setting the `CODEQL_LOCAL_RUN` env var will fill in missing env vars
that the action needs, but isn't set by `act`. It will also avoid
making api calls to github that would fail locally.
This is a refactoring discussed in
https://github.com/github/dsp-codeql/issues/36
2020-08-04 14:35:20 -07:00
Robert Brignull
0086c2ecdb
use @actions/github
2020-07-06 16:25:26 +01:00
Chris Gavin
74c48f71fa
Use a single Octokit client for everything rather than a bunch of Octokits and an HTTP client.
2020-06-23 21:40:42 +01:00